US Citizens and Pandemic Unemployment Compensation

Featured Replies

Anyone know if US citizens working for US companies overseas (who've laid them off because of corona situation) are eligible to apply for unemployment benefits?

Depend upon whether or not your company took unemployment, FICA, and Social Security out of your pay check, kind of doubt is though,  since not having to pay those taxes is one of the incentives to get employees to take overseas assignments

 

But if you are working as a civilian as a Department of Defense contractor or other US government agency then you are probably covered but would have to apply in your home state, since unemployment is handled at the state level 

 

Just hope your state doesn't have an in person registration requirement
